Neocancilla hebes is a species of sea snail, a marine gastropod mollusk in the family Mitridae, the miters or miter snails.[1]
Description
The shell size varies between 10 mm and 70 mm
Distribution
This species is distributed in the Atlantic Ocean along West Africa, Cape Verde, São Tomé y Principe and Gabon
